LCM( 20, 26, 28 ) = 1820
Step 1: Write down factorisation of each number:
20 = 2 · 2 · 5
26 = 2 · 13
28 = 2 · 2 · 7
Step 2 : Match primes vertically:

Step 3 : Bring down numbers in each column and multiply to get LCM:

LCM | = | 2 | · | 2 | · | 5 | · | 7 | · | 13 | = | 1820 |
